I'm loving my Dell Vostro 1520
I purchased a new Laptop on 1st November 2009. This is my first laptop. Its a Dell Vostro 1520.
Those of you who have seen this laptop, might be thinking, "what an idiot! spending the money on a box". Well gentlemen, what you consider a box, is actually my style and so I have no complaints for its boxy look. And what should I have bought instead of this box... Inspiron??? Though I would have got the same config for a lesser price, but what about the looks? It would have had a screen which could be used as a mirror(not a plus point)... also the whole body would be reflecting when you are working. I don't like such laptops. And its better to have a box, which has a AntiGlare screen and a matte finish. I love the looks of this.
I'm also liking the keyboard, though its not very well finished(the H key is slightly tilted, but its not creating much problems). I had read about heating issues which people have faced. I was very concerned since I didn't want too much heat. But now I'm pretty satisfied since the left palmrest is only little warm than the right palmrest and it is not too uncomfortable. Also the sound level is very low. And if it remains at this level I have no issues.
The speakers are not world-class. I would have spent a few extra bucks if I could have got better speakers, but since there was no such option I'm ok with it.
At present the battery backup is 4 hrs with audio on, and brightness level 3.
The laptop is looking good. I am not looking forward to do any experimentation with it. I hope it does a good job for me. I am satisfied with what I have got right now. I wish it keeps working the same way.
And if someone doesn't mind a box, he should buy this... its good for the price.
